The sapphires are lovely indeed and have a color variation between inside lighting conditions and full sun outdoors. Outdoors the color of these unheated untreated sapphires is a medium denim blue and indoors I would describe the color as denim a blue with a dash of gray spun into the color. Like all sapphires different lighting conditions will result in slightly different hues/shades and that effect is very beautiful in these particular stones. The central cabochon is a little darker than the six surrounding cabochons. There are some light chatoyant inclusions to some of these cabochons with most being eye clean- the sapphires are transparent except for a single translucent/semi-transparent stone. There are no modern treatments, no heat treatment these fine gem quality sapphires have been polished only and are just as mother nature made them. The total sapphire weight is 5.8 carats.

Decorating the outside of the floral dome there are old cut natural sparkling white diamonds, a total of 48 with a combined diamond weight of 1 carat as estimated in the setting. These are F/G in color and mainly VS/I (mainly VS a very few SI and one I) in clarity. At the time of this ring was made it is important to note that modern diamond grading standards were not in use. Comment:
Unfortunately, in the last two decades many sapphires seen in modern jewelry have had the color induced by high temperature heating in chemicals such as beryllium. This is called diffusion treatment and includes surface diffusion, bulk diffusion, lattice diffusion, deep diffusion and beryllium treatment. In recent years sapphires have been clarity enhanced by filling any fissures or cracks with molten lead glass, sometimes the glass is colored as well, with time the filler falls out or goes cloudy ruining the stone. Polymer resins can be used in a similar way. Colored coatings can be applied to the back of a sapphire. These treatments are unacceptable and such treated stones are of very low value. We do not sell sapphires with these treatments.
